What's New – Simplified tools for designing with contour lines

Oct 28, 2025

Today we are releasing an update that simplifies our contour tools for editing the terrain in workspaces.  Our open contours - contours that are not closed rings - are now more powerful and affect a larger part of the surrounding terrain.  It is no longer necessary to take great care that the open contour lines start and end on a special boundary curve - just draw your design, and Scalgo Live takes care of the rest! This means that it is easier to sculpt the terrain, and even designing sloped terrains, using the open contour tools. This is particularly useful for easily bringing a landscape design from CAD software into Scalgo Live.

As part of this change we have removed the "dividing contour tool". Contour groups created with dividing contours will still work as expected, but no new ones can be created.
